X 
微信扫码联系客服
获取报价、解决方案


李经理
15150181012
首页 > 知识库 > 统一消息平台> 大数据驱动下的统一消息服务在农业大学的应用
统一消息平台在线试用
统一消息平台
在线试用
统一消息平台解决方案
统一消息平台
解决方案下载
统一消息平台源码
统一消息平台
源码授权
统一消息平台报价
统一消息平台
产品报价

大数据驱动下的统一消息服务在农业大学的应用

2024-11-04 03:06

小明: 嘿,小华,我们最近在讨论如何更好地利用大数据技术提升农业大学的信息传递效率,你有什么好的建议吗?

小华: 当然有啦!我们可以使用统一消息服务(Unified Messaging Service, UMS)来实现这一点。UMS能帮助我们集中管理不同渠道的消息发送,比如电子邮件、短信、微信等。

小明: 那么,我们该如何开始呢?

小华: 首先,我们需要收集和分析学生和教职员工的数据,包括他们的偏好、接收信息的习惯等,这需要用到大数据技术。

小明: 我们可以使用Hadoop进行数据分析吧?

小华: 是的,Hadoop非常适合处理大量数据。我们可以使用MapReduce编写程序来分析这些数据,找出最佳的消息发送策略。

小明: 那么,UMS的具体实现步骤是什么?

小华: 首先,我们需要选择一个UMS平台,比如阿里云的消息队列服务。然后,根据收集到的数据配置不同的消息模板,并设置触发条件。

系统实现单点登录

小明: 能给我一个简单的代码示例吗?

小华: 当然可以。以下是一个使用Python调用阿里云消息队列服务发送短信的简单示例:

import json

from aliyunsdkcore.client import AcsClient

from aliyunsdkcore.profile import region_provider

from aliyunsdkcore.request import CommonRequest

ACCESS_KEY_ID = 'your-access-key-id'

ACCESS_KEY_SECRET = 'your-access-key-secret'

client = AcsClient(ACCESS_KEY_ID, ACCESS_KEY_SECRET, 'cn-hangzhou')

request = CommonRequest()

request.set_domain('dysmsapi.aliyuncs.com')

request.set_version('2017-05-25')

request.set_action_name('SendSms')

request.add_query_param('RegionId', "cn-hangzhou")

request.add_query_param('PhoneNumbers', "12345678901")

request.add_query_param('SignName', "您的签名名称")

request.add_query_param('TemplateCode', "SMS_123456789")

统一消息平台

response = client.do_action(request)

print(str(response, encoding='utf-8'))

统一消息服务

]]>

小明: 这样一来,我们就能更加高效地将重要信息传达给每一位师生了。

本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!